A Study of Talquetamab for People With Multiple Myeloma Who Have Received BCMA CAR T-Cell Therapy

The researchers are doing this study to find out whether talquetamab is an effective treatment after BCMA CAR Tcell therapy for people with relapsed or refractory multiple myeloma. All participants in this study will have already received the BCMA CAR T-cell therapy ide-cel for their disease.

18 years of age All Phase 2

Prehabilitation Feasibility Among Older Adults Undergoing Transplantation

This is a pilot feasibility trial among older adults (≥60y) scheduled to undergo Autologous Stem Cell transplantation at UAB. Participants will be randomized into either a prehabilitation program or an attention control group before their transplant. The primary outcomes will be feasibility and secondary outcomes include changes in physical function …

60 years of age All Phase N/A
